18@8 KUL-SIN by Wei-Ling Gallery at ION Art 12 - 19 Dec, 10am - 10pm, FREE

Since its inaugural event in 2005, 18@8 has turned into a definitive annual event in the Malaysian arts scene. Now in its eighth edition, the first instalment for this year’s exhibition will be showcased at ION Art, bringing together compelling and iconic art pieces by 18 leading and emerging contemporary artists from and Singapore. ION Art Gallery Level 4, ION Orchard, 2 Orchard Turn, Singapore 238801

ALIEN GHOST 2012 15 Dec, 8pm, $28 - $108 Alien Huang has gained recognition in the music scene with his rock tunes and love songs since his debut ten years ago. Come Dec 15, his Ghost concert in Singapore will feature flamboyant stage costumes, brand-new choreographed dances and a specially-designed concert track listing. ANUGERAH PLANET MUZIK 2012 15 Dec, 8.30pm, $48 - $88 The prestigious Anugerah Planet Muzik returns for its 11th year on Dec 15, at Max Pavilion at Singapore Expo. An annual award ceremony that gives recognition to artistes and musicians of the regional Malay music scene, it promises to inject new elements to the award categories and up the ante of the show’s entertainment value. FRENCH MOVIES 2012: RIDICULE 18 Dec, 8pm, $7.20 To get royal backing on a needed drainage project, a poor French lord must learn to play the delicate games of wit at court at Versailles. An unwitting nobleman soon discovers that survival at court demands both a razor wit and an acid tongue. This is a very intelligent movie and from a historical viewpoint, it shows how cruel and vain the French aristocracy was before the French Revolution of 1789. The warmth of the sun against your skin, the gentle nudging of the waves as they meet the shore and the cooling lull of the sea breeze make Sentosa a perfect haven for a carefree day. Palawan Beach is family-friendly and sure to re- energise all, from young to old. With its tall coconut palms and rustic alang alang huts, the beauty of the landscape has a therapeutic effect whether you’re sun tanning or enjoying an exciting game of volleyball. In this final edition of the Sentosa Playcation series, we bring you the latest highlights from school holiday activities specially designed to give children a rollicking good time on this sunny resort islet. Don’t forget your sunscreen and cameras!

Puppetry Fun From Dec 17 to 30, come down for the exciting Puppet Master Musical. With shows at 4.30pm and 7pm every Wednesday to Sunday, the musical promises half an hour of lively entertainment as colourful characters emerge from a big musical box. Meet fun characters with loud, wacky costumes and be enthralled by their song and dance. Catch the friendly Puppet Master as he takes you on a journey with his favourite puppet and his friends. Watch as they try to catch the missing star, and kids can come on a journey together as the sparkle is returned to a magical fairy wand. This will definitely be a memorable experience for children as they get to immerse themselves fully in the interactive storytelling experience.

Ready, get set, play! After checking out the exciting Playmobil fort with life-sized playmates and mascots, the young ones can indulge in some raucous fun in the Playmobil Challenge. From 5.30pm to 6pm, children can get ready to enjoy fun games such as Simple Simon, Treasure Hunting and Playmobil Statue. In Simple Simon, kids can test their response times by seeing how fast they can respond to the wacky host’s instructions. Be on the alert and try not to miss a beat! Children will also be entertained when they go on a mini-treasure hunt and try to uncover all the hidden precious treasures. The most resourceful ones with the most loot will be crowned the winner. In the Playmobil Statue, the task is simple. Children only have to stand as still as a Playmobil figurine in order to win. Winners stand to win attractive prizes which include Playmobil figurines, so resist the urge to squirm or giggle.
